Hilbert College is a private, Catholic, Franciscan college. Founded in 1957, it adopted coeducation in 1969. Its 49-acre campus is located in the town of Hamburg, 10 miles from Buffalo.
University of San Diego, founded in 1949, is a private, Roman Catholic university. Its 180-acre, suburban campus is located centrally in San Diego.
University of Providence (formerly The University of Great Falls), founded in 1932, is a Catholic, liberal arts university. Its 44-acre campus is located in Great Falls, Montana.
Touro College in New York, founded in 1971, is a private college part of the Touro College and University System, the largest not-for-profit independent institution of higher and professional education under Jewish auspices in the country. Its urban campus is located in downtown Manhattan.
Calumet College of St. Joseph, founded in 1951, is a church-affiliated, liberal arts college. Its campus is located in Whiting, IN, 18 miles from downtown Chicago.

Clayton State University, founded in 1969, is a public, multipurpose institution. Programs are offered through the Schools of Arts and Sciences, Business, Health Sciences, and Technology. Its 163-acre campus is located in Morrow, 10 miles from Atlanta.
St. Thomas University, founded in 1961, is a private Catholic university. Its 150-acre campus is located in Miami, Florida.
Nova Southeastern University, founded in 1964, is a private, liberal arts university. Its 314-acre campus is located 10 miles from downtown Fort Lauderdale.
